Timothée Chalamet Praises Apple’s Taste in Ongoing TV+ Ad Campaign
Chalamet uses an iPad to longingly look through various Apple TV+ shows and movies, naming the high-profile actors and actresses that star in the TV+ content. “Alright Apple, clearly you have taste,” says Chalamet, and the spot eventually ends with him asking Apple to “talk.”
The ad is similar to a “Call Me” spot that Apple shared earlier in January, where Chalamet expressed his desire to star in an Apple TV+ show. Apple’s ad campaign is clearly leading up to announcement of an Apple TV+ series or movie starring Chalamet, as the company did something similar with Jon Hamm before he was announced as a cast member of “The Morning Show.”

If you want a taste of what Final Fantasy 16 will play like, you need to try this PlayStation Plus game right now
Final Fantasy 16 has a lot going for it. As well as a return to a more traditional fantasy world – eschewing the apocalyptic boyband aesthetic of the previous game – the game seems to have a more serious tone, a world packed with political intrigue, and a core cast of characters with grizzly backstories, potent motivations, and suitably unlikely names. By remembering what made the series great, Square Enix’s next blockbuster RPG could right the recent wrongs of the series.
But, despite some of the ways the game is returning to Final Fantasy’s retro roots, there is one place the game is innovating: combat. Early on in the game’s life, it was confirmed that Final Fantasy 16 will not feature turn-based combat – something that was a staple in the games up until Final Fantasy 12. Instead, the action will focus more on real-time, player-directed sequences similar to something a player may find in, let’s say, Devil May Cry 5.
And that’s not just me pulling a name out of an air juggle combo to make a point. Final Fantasy 16 has employed the talents of DMC5’s combat director, Ryota Suzuki, to head up the action in this game. After fumbling the combat a bit in Final Fantasy 15, and realising that some bastard hybrid of real-time and turn-based isn’t really what a new numbered title in the series needs, Final Fantasy 16 has fully committed to pulling the devil trigger and going all in on the excitement. And I couldn’t be happier about that.
Man hurled egg at King Charles because his ‘visit to poor area was in bad taste’
A MAN threw an egg towards the King because he thought his visit to a poor area was in “bad taste”, a court heard.
Police seized Harry May, 21, after his projectile landed near Charles on December’s walkabout.
King Charles had an egg hurled at him during a walkabout in Luton[/caption]
Cops seized Harry May, 21, after his egg landed near Charles on December’s walkabout[/caption]
Officers found a second egg in an empty soup tin inside his jacket.
Prosecutor Jason Seetal told JPs: “He believed the King visiting a town like Luton, a deprived and poor area, was in bad taste and he wanted to make a point of this.”
May, of Luton, admitted a public order offence yesterday.
Westminster magistrates fined him £100 with £85 costs.
Alex Benn, defending, said May “deeply regrets” his actions.
They said: “He cares deeply about his local community.”
JP Paul Goldspring said: “Whatever disagreement you have, the way to resolve it is not to throw projectiles.”
